Who needs about form 8879-eo irs?

01
Form 8879-EO is needed by tax-exempt organizations that are electronically filing an annual return with the IRS.
02
This form is specifically for the electronic filing of Form 990, 990-EZ, or 990-PF by tax-exempt organizations.
03
It must be signed by an authorized representative of the organization and the electronic return originator.

Form 8879-EO is the IRS e-file Signature Authorization for Exempt Organizations, allowing tax-exempt organizations to electronically file their tax returns.
Tax-exempt organizations that file Form 990, 990-EZ, or 990-PF and wish to submit their forms electronically are required to file Form 8879-EO.
To fill out Form 8879-EO, organizations must provide identifying information, including their name, EIN, and the name of the person authorized to sign the return electronically, and then sign and date the form.
The purpose of Form 8879-EO is to authorize the electronic filing of Form 990 series returns and to provide a record of the signature and consent of the organization's authorized representative.
Form 8879-EO requires the organization's name, Employer Identification Number (EIN), tax period, and the name and title of the authorized representative. A declaration that the information is correct must also be included.
